Description:The painting depicts leaves of a special plant that are used for medical purposes. Women go to different places around her country, Utopia, to collect such leaves. Once selected the leaves are boiled to extract resin and Kangaroo fat is mixed through, creating a paste that can be stored in the bush for extended periods. The medicine is used to heal cuts, bites, burns, rashes and also acts as an insect repellant.

Jeannie Petyarre was born at Utopia and her country is Atnangkerre. She lives at Mosquito Bore Outstation in the Utopia region.
